Position Summary

We are hiring an experienced Sales Manager to lead and oversee the sales operations in our Negombo region. This role involves managing a team, setting realistic sales targets, developing territory-specific strategies, and ensuring that day-to-day sales activities are executed effectively and ethically. The ideal candidate will be someone who understands the local market, knows how to build and maintain relationships, and has a steady track record of managing a team toward measurable results.

This position is suited for someone who is not looking for shortcuts or motivational catchphrases but understands the hard work and consistency required in running a sales operation.


Core Responsibilities

1. Team Management

  • Supervise a team of sales representatives, including recruitment, onboarding, training, and ongoing performance management.
  • Set individual sales targets based on territory performance and team capability.
  • Monitor progress daily and weekly, and provide practical feedback to help team members meet their goals.
  • Ensure adherence to company policies, pricing guidelines, and reporting protocols.

2. Sales Operations

  • Oversee and coordinate all sales activities within the assigned region.
  • Ensure that product/service knowledge across the team is current and accurate.
  • Track and manage sales pipeline activities using the designated system or CRM.
  • Regularly review and audit sales reports, client interactions, and deal closures to maintain transparency and accountability.

3. Market Development

  • Identify and pursue new sales opportunities in both existing and untapped markets.
  • Collect field-level data on customer preferences, competitor activity, and market trends.
  • Recommend adjustments to sales strategies or pricing models based on accurate local insights.
  • Maintain a detailed understanding of the Negombo commercial environment, including seasonal changes, demographic trends, and infrastructure developments.

4. Client Relationship Management

  • Build and maintain long-term relationships with key clients, distributors, and partners.
  • Resolve customer complaints promptly and appropriately, escalating when necessary.
  • Negotiate contracts and agreements, ensuring that all terms are clearly documented and adhered to.
  • Visit top accounts regularly to maintain service quality and business continuity.

5. Reporting and Analysis

  • Submit weekly, monthly, and quarterly reports summarizing team performance, revenue, challenges, and upcoming opportunities.
  • Review sales forecasts versus actual performance and explain any significant variances.
  • Provide grounded recommendations for resource allocation, staffing, and promotional efforts.

6. Compliance and Ethics

  • Ensure all team activities are aligned with legal, ethical, and company-specific guidelines.
  • Maintain proper documentation of all transactions and customer communications.
  • Address any internal misconduct or sales manipulation swiftly and according to procedure.

Performance Expectations

Within the first 3 months, the Sales Manager is expected to:

  • Conduct a full assessment of the assigned territory and submit a report on strengths, weaknesses, and immediate goals.
  • Meet with all key accounts and evaluate client satisfaction.
  • Train the team on any observed skill gaps or knowledge issues.
  • Review current sales materials and recommend updates if necessary.

By the 6-month mark, we expect:

  • Sales performance to stabilize with a predictable pipeline.
  • At least 70% of the team consistently meeting individual monthly targets.
  • Improved client retention and decreased unresolved complaints.
